Azzedine Ounahi, the Moroccan national team midfielder, received the award for best player in the match against Canada at the World Cup.

Ounahi shone during the match and scored a brace as part of Morocco's 3-0 victory over Canada.
The Moroccan national team qualified for the round of 8 in the 2026 World Cup after defeating Canada 3-0 in the round of 16.
Morocco defeated Canada, one of the host countries of the tournament along with the United States and Mexico, reaching the round of 8 in the World Cup for the second consecutive time.
In the round of 8, the Moroccan national team will face the winner of the match between France and Paraguay.
Morocco became the first African team to reach the quarterfinals of the World Cup two consecutive times.
Morocco's hat-trick was scored by Azzedine Ounahi with two goals, and a goal by Sofiane Rahimi in stoppage time.

Alongside the main Moroccan commentator for the match, Jawad Badda, the Tunisian Issam Shawali was present on a second channel.
Since the beginning of the World Cup, Shawali has not had luck in his commentary on matches of Arab or African teams, all of whom exited the tournament during his commentary.
This led Issam Shawali to mock himself on air during his commentary on one of the matches in a humorous way, pointing to the bad luck of the teams he comments on.
With the revelation that Issam Shawali was commentating on the match, some began to fear for the Moroccan national team in the match against Canada.
However, Azzedine Ounahi did justice to Issam Shawali by scoring a brace in Morocco's victory over Canada, ending the idea of bad luck for Arab and African teams with Issam Shawali.
